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A system and method for a rotary drive for a curved track section of a conveyor. The system includes: a rotary motor; a wheel provided to the curved track section and driven by the rotary motor, the wheel includes an engagement mechanism configured to engage with a moving element; and a control system configured to control the wheel/rotary motor, such that the engagement mechanism engages a moving element adjacent a beginning of the curved track section and controls the moving element through the curved track section and releases the moving element adjacent an end of the curved track section. The method includes: moving a moving element toward the curved track section; controlling at least one of the moving element and a wheel such that the moving element and the wheel engage; controlling the moving element on the curved track section; and releasing the moving element.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A rotary drive system for a curved track section of a conveyor, wherein the conveyor includes at least one straight track section that feeds into or out of the curved track section, the system comprising: a rotary motor; a star wheel provided to the curved track section and driven by the rotary motor, wherein the star wheel comprises at least one spoke configured to engage with a recess provided on a moving element on the conveyor, wherein the at least one spoke comprises, at a distal end thereof, a biasing member configured to allow the at least one spoke to flex in one or more directions and at least one bearing coupled with the biasing member: a control system configured to control the star wheel, via the rotary motor, such that the at least one spoke engages the moving element adjacent a beginning of the curved track section and controls the moving element through the curved track section and releases the moving element adjacent an end of the curved track section. 2. A system according to claim 1 wherein the engagement mechanism comprises a moving element engagement mechanism comprising a friction pad biased toward the star wheel and a friction surface on the star wheel configured to engage the friction pad. 3. A system according to claim 1 further comprising a magnetic element provided to the curved track section and to the moving element to attract the moving element toward the curved track section with sufficient magnetic force to support the moving element while also allowing the rotary drive to move the moving element. 4. A system according to claim 1 wherein the curved track section comprises an electromagnetic drive for driving the moving element and the control system is configured to control the rotary drive and electromagnetic drive to operate such that the at least one spoke and an engaged moving element move at the same speed. 5. A system according to claim 1 further comprising one or more guide rails provided to the curved track section wherein the one or more guide rails are aligned with one or more guide rails on an adjacent section of the conveyor. 6. A system according to claim 1 wherein the star wheel is provided at a bottom of the curved track section. 7. A system according to claim 1 wherein the rotary drive is a servo drive. 8. A method for controlling a curved track section of a conveyor, the method comprising: moving a moving element on a first linear motor drive straight track section of the conveyor toward the curved track section via the linear motor drive: controlling at least one of the linear motor drive and a rotary drive of a star wheel such that a recess provided to the moving element and a spoke of the star wheel engage adjacent to the curved track section, wherein the spoke comprises a biasing member and a bearing, at a distal end thereof; controlling the moving element on the curved track section via the rotary drive of the star wheel; releasing the moving element from the spoke of the star wheel onto a second linear motor drive straight track section of the conveyor by continued rotation of the star wheel. 9. A method according to claim 8 wherein the first and second straight track sections are the same straight track section. 10. A method according to claim 8 wherein the moving element and the star wheel engage in a synchronized manner. 11. A method according to claim 8 wherein the recess on the moving element and the spoke on the star wheel are held together by a locking mechanism.
